8 Blaire Willson

  • Height 5-3
  • Class Sophomore
  • Highschool Kingsburg HS
  • Hometown Kingsburg

Biography

As a Sophomore (2023)
- Started 14 of 37 games with all starts in the outfield
- Hit .246 with 3 doubles and 7 RBIs
- Went 2-for-4 with a double and a RBI against Holy Names (March 31)

As a Freshman (2022)
- Played in 27 games for the Wildcats as a true freshman in 2022, making 11 starts
- Recorded her first career Wildcat hit February 19, 2022 vs. Cal State Monterey Bay
- Batted .500 (7-for-14) over a four-game stretch March 5–19, 2022
- Earned 2021–22 CCAA All-Academic honors

Pre-Chico Days
A 2021 graduate of Kingsburg High School
- Four-year varsity letter winner
- Helped lead the Vikings to a pair of Central Sequoia League titles and the 2019 CIF Central Section Division II championship
- First-team All-CSL selection as a senior
- Also lettered in soccer, and was part of four CSL and three Central Coast Section title teams
- All-League Academic Award winner in both softball and soccer
